A NEW international air cargo route linking Ezhou Huahu Airport in central China's Hubei Province with Hungarian capital Budapest was launched early this week, according to SF Airlines.
The Ezhou-Budapest cargo route is the first air cargo route linking Hungary from Ezhou Huahu Airport, China's first cargo-focused airport. It is also SF Airlines' third route from this airport to Europe, the airline said, according to Xinhua.
Operated by B747-400 freighter, the weekly round-trip flight will provide a capacity of more than 200 tonnes of aircargo.
This direct air route will mainly serve parcel express, and e-commerce goods, among others. It will expand channels for air logistics between the two countries and boost China-Europe economic exchanges, according to SF Airlines.
The Ezhou Huahu Airport began operations in July 2022. In April 2023, it opened its first international cargo route carried by SF Airlines.
Headquartered in Shenzhen, SF Airlines is China's largest air cargo carrier in fleet size and operates services from Ezhou to destinations in Europe, North America, Middle East, South Asia, Southeast Asia and East Asia.
